The Importance of B2B Matching in Global Business
1. Efficient Market Entry
B2B matching helps companies enter new markets faster and more effectively by connecting them with qualified, local partners such as distributors, buyers, or service providers.
🔍 Instead of starting from scratch, companies can build on pre-established local relationships.
2. Targeted Business Opportunities
Matching is curated based on business needs, ensuring that meetings are meaningful and relevant. It saves time and resources by focusing only on potentially fruitful partnerships.
🎯 Right people, right time, right purpose.
3. Facilitates International Trade & Investment
B2B matching plays a key role in expanding cross-border trade, technology exchange, and foreign direct investment (FDI), especially in developing economies or emerging sectors.
🌍 It bridges the gap between global supply and local demand.
4. Builds Long-Term Business Relationships
These connections are not just about one-time deals — they often lead to joint ventures, long-term supply agreements, co-developments, or strategic alliances.
🤝 Business begins with trust — and trust begins with real connection.
5. Promotes Economic Diplomacy
For governments and trade agencies, B2B programs support bilateral or multilateral cooperation, strengthening diplomatic ties through economic engagement.
🏛️ Trade builds peace and prosperity.
6. Supports SMEs and Startups
Smaller companies often lack the networks to grow internationally. B2B matching gives them access to global platforms they wouldn’t reach on their own.
🚀 It levels the playing field for smaller innovators.
7. Increases Event ROI
When part of trade shows or business missions, B2B matching boosts the value of participation by turning passive attendance into active deal-making.
